Why contrast decides whether your icon gets seen
App stores render icons against a white-ish background in light mode and a near-black one in dark mode, with no border added on iOS beyond the corner mask. An icon whose outer regions are close to either extreme loses its silhouette on that theme — white-background icons famously melt into the light App Store, and very dark icons do the same in dark mode. Internal contrast matters just as much: if your glyph’s luminance sits close to its own background fill, the whole mark reads as a single flat tile at search-result size, and users’ eyes slide straight past it to a neighbor with a bolder figure-ground relationship.
Contrast also carries accessibility weight. Roughly 8% of men have some form of color vision deficiency, and an icon that separates its elements only by hue — red glyph on green field, for example — can collapse into a uniform blob for those users. Luminance contrast, the thing this tool measures, survives every type of color blindness, which is why it is the right axis to optimize.
Complexity: the other way icons disappear
An icon can have excellent contrast and still fail at small sizes because it contains too much: gradients layered on textures, multiple objects, thin outlines, or — the classic mistake — words. The checker’s complexity estimate approximates this by measuring edge density: how much of the image is transitions rather than flat regions. Great small-size icons are surprisingly empty; think of the most recognizable apps on your own home screen and count their elements — most use one shape, two or three colors, and no text.
When the tool flags high complexity, the fix is subtraction, not adjustment. Remove secondary objects, merge similar tones into one, thicken any stroke below about 3% of the icon’s width, and delete text entirely (your app name already appears next to the icon everywhere it matters). Frequently asked questions
What does the contrast score measure?
Luminance separation between your icon’s dominant tonal regions — effectively how strongly the foreground shape stands apart from its background fill. Higher separation means the icon keeps a clear silhouette when rendered small against store backgrounds.
Why do white or very light icons perform poorly?
The App Store and Google Play both use light backgrounds in their default themes, and iOS adds no border around icons. A white or near-white icon has no visible edge against that background, so it loses its shape and reads as a hole in the layout rather than an app.
Does my icon need to work in dark mode too?
Yes — both stores and both operating systems have dark themes, and iOS 18 additionally lets users apply dark and tinted icon variants on the home screen. Check your icon against both light and dark backdrops; mid-tone backgrounds with strong internal contrast tend to survive both.

What is a good complexity level for an app icon?
Low. The most effective store icons use a single focal shape, two to four colors, and no text. If the tool reports high edge density, remove elements rather than shrinking them — detail that needs squinting at 60 px is detail working against you.
